July 28, 2016: Tyler Hoechlin and Melissa Benoist Talk About Superman

Supergirl and SupermanEmpire Online had the opportunity to sit down with Melissa Benoist, Tyler Hoechlin, and other members of the cast of the “Supergirl” TV series to discuss the arrival of Superman in Season 2. Here’s part of the interview…

Hoechlin: This show is so hopeful and optimistic and Superman fits right in there. It’s the ‘truth, justice and the American way’ element that I love. That’s the person you hope would exist and do what he does with the powers that he has. They’re just trying to embody that and there’s obviously struggles that go along with being someone who has that much responsibility. But in the end I think he’s incredibly happy to be able to do what he can do.

Benoist: Hope remains a key ingredient of the show. One of the things that I admired most about Kara is her sheer will and the fact that she never, ever gives up, even when things are grimmest. It’s a quality that runs in the family.

Hoechlin: Not to just sit on that word, but I do think Superman’s role is one of hope. The belief that things can be better and people with powers will do good things. I know it’s one of the issues right now in the world in that there are a lot of people in power who, if you look at it on the surface, you just assume are either self-serving or ‘evil’. But here you have someone who is capable of really taking over, but he chooses not to use his powers selfishly. Instead he helps other people. That is such a symbol and statement of who he truly is. That’s something I would really want to focus on; to make it a top priority of who he is.
